1966 Lost in Space Question

Was the 1966 Lost in Space card set printed on an 11x5 sheet? If so, has anyone ever seen an uncut sheet? I seem to recall that some collectors of this great 55-card set believe there are shortprints, which I guess would rule out the 11x5 theory.

    Good day,
    I have never seen a sheet, but they were probably manufactured in sheets as were most sets from Topp during that era. Whether they were or weren't I still don't belive there are short prints. Being the owner of several sets and having bought and sold dozens over the years, the contention of short prints is simply hype to try and bleed a little more money out of some cards. I have never had any problem finding a particular number and have noticed over the years the claims of Short prints periodically change numbers. Hope this helps.
